One of my favorite shows is the
Electrical Water Pageant lighting up the Seven Seas Lagoon and Bay Lake. I get a huge smile on my face as over 50,000 lights sparkle across the water and try to catch this show every trip. Pageant times vary seasonally and I advise checking with your Disney Resort hotel front desk regarding showtimes. You may also check the My Disney Experience mobile app that day for times. Remember this is an outdoor show and subject to weather. While there is a show outside of Magic Kingdom Park during
extended theme park hours the best views are from the Resorts on the shores of the Seven Seas Lagoon or Bay Lake. My favorite is just out the back doors of the Boca Chica building at Disney's Grand Floridian Resort & Spa. Wow! what a view. I suggest reviewing the time when the show is at Disney's Grand Floridian Resort & Spa and take the monorail from Magic Kingdom Park then return for
Happily Ever After fireworks. Plan on a comfortable 40 minutes of travel time to get to your pageant viewing spot.
At Magic Kingdom Park, all Guests using the Walt Disney World Bus Service/Minnie Van Service are dropped off and picked up just outside the main entrance where the bus depot is located. You save about 20 minutes of time because you do not need the monorail or ferry boat. The Transportation and Ticket Center is for Guests with personal transportation or using third-party services like Uber/Lyft.
